Project Compliance Administrator

Grimsby

£22,000

Fixed term contract – 3 years, 37 hour week

We have a newly created vacancy for an experienced Compliance Administrator to work within a small friendly team of a successful, well known and well established, social enterprise organisation. Your main role as the Compliance Administrator is to provide administrative and logistical support to a team comprising of Business Manager, Performance Manager as well as Business Advisors and Business Partners. It is imperative that you are experienced with compliance, and audit process systems, a knowledge of fund working would be advantageous. To fulfil the specification within this role you may come from the public sector or perhaps a legal background, or similar, where you are used to working to set procedures. If you are a Compliance Administrator, used to working with SME’s you will find this a most rewarding role. The post offers 25 days annual leave, plus bank holidays. It would be desirable if you are a car driver with access to a vehicle with suitable business insurance.

Key responsibilities – Compliance Administrator:

 

  • To maintain comprehensive and accurate records of SME activity, registration and monitoring information
  • To check Business Compliance before Assistance is provided
  • To co-ordinate records of all documentation and communication with SME clients involved in the project, maintaining full records of this communication
  • To assist in the promotion of project events/workshops/open days targeting SME recruitment onto the project; co-ordinating SME responses to the promotional activity and passing leads on accordingly to the Project Manager. To ensure the completion and collation of appropriate paperwork for such events.
  • To assist with the preparation of project documents and financial reports
  • To maintain records of project activities and liaise with project team members.
  • To take minutes of project meetings
  • To carry out any other duties appropriate to the post as determined by the Performance Manager

 

Personal specification – Compliance Administrator:

 

  • Microsoft Office skills (Excel, Word, PowerPoint, Outlook)
  • Experience with audit against project requirements
  • Good organisational and time management skills
  • Excellent communication skills both written and oral
  • Interest and knowledge of SME business support
  • Excellent time management and prioritisation skills
  • An effective team player with the ability to work independently
